NOAA Scatterometer Wind Retrievals from the Scatsat-1 Mission

2019 
In this paper, we present the SCATSAT-1 wind data processor developed by NOAA. The sigma0 from L1B produced by ISRO was used as an input to our processor. Ocean surface wind vector products are produced at the grid resolutions of 12.5 km and 25 km. We experimented with different objective functions and the number of solutions. The ambiguity removal method utilized in our processor is the Two-Dimensional Variational Ambiguity Removal (2DVAR). The rain flag algorithm was developed based on the Bayes’ theorem by calculating the rain probability given the rain sensitive parameter threshold.Finally, we validated our Scatsat-1 wind retrievals by both statistical analyses and visual inspection of the wind field for meteorological consistency to determine which objective function produced the best results. The performance of the Scatsat-1 wind retrievals compared to the Global Data Assimilation System (GDAS) winds shows reasonable wind speed and wind direction biases and standard deviation differences.
